House Leveling in Englewood, FL
House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ation of a property to correct uneven or settling floors, cracks, and other structural issues caused by soil movement or aging. These services typically cover residential homes experiencing foundation settlement, sagging floors, or shifting walls, ensuring the stability and safety of the building. Homeowners often seek house leveling when noticing signs of structural distress, such as sloping flo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, to restore the property’s integrity and prevent further damage.
Before requesting house leveling services, property owners should understand the extent of the foundation issues and whether structural repairs are necessary. It’s important to evaluate the underlying causes of settling, such as soil conditions or drainage problems, to determine the appropriate approach. Clear communication about the specific concerns and visible symptoms can help identify the most effective solution. Consulting with experienced specialists can provide insight into the scope of work needed to stabilize the foundation and ensure the long-term durability of the property.

Common House Leveling Jobs
Foundation leveling - corrects uneven or settling foundations to ensure stability.
Slab jacking - raises sunken concrete slabs to restore proper levelness.
Pier and beam leveling - adjusts and stabilizes pier and beam structures for safety.
Basement floor leveling - repairs uneven basement floors to prevent further damage.
Structural repairs - addresses underlying issues causing foundation or floor shifts.
Post-installation adjustments - fine-tunes existing leveling work for long-term stability.
House Leveling Questions
What causes a house to settle unevenly? Factors like soil erosion, moisture changes, and poor foundation support can lead to uneven settling of a home.
How can I tell if my house needs leveling? Signs include c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
What types of foundation issues are addressed with house leveling? Common problems include sinking, cracking, and shifting foundations that affect the stability of the structure.
Is house leveling suitable for all types of foundations? It is typically effective for concrete slabs, pier and beam, and crawl space foundations experiencing uneven settlement.
